How strong was this earthquake?

Strong earthquakes can cause significant damage in populated areas within roughly 100 km of the epicentre, particularly to older masonry buildings. Landslides and liquefaction become a real risk in susceptible ground.

A magnitude 6.1 earthquake radiates roughly 21,301 tons of TNT equivalent in seismic energy.

The USGS assigns this earthquake a significance score of 572, which is below the USGS threshold of more than 600 for its significant-earthquake list. The ranking combines magnitude with available Did You Feel It responses and PAGER alert level; it is not a direct measurement of damage.

Why the 10 km depth matters

At 10 km this was a shallow earthquake. Shallow events release their energy close to the surface, so for a given magnitude they produce noticeably stronger shaking — and more damage — than deeper ones. Roughly three quarters of all earthquakes worldwide occur at shallow depths.

What does the tsunami information flag mean?

The USGS record does not carry a link to NOAA tsunami information. That field is not an all-clear and does not state whether a tsunami occurred.
